Pass the Popcorn! My Movie Pass Experience....

     My husband and I were looking for a source of entertainment that wasn't overly costly to keep up our fun date night at a reasonable rate.  I'd heard bits and pieces of people talking about Movie Pass.  Movie pass is an app/card that you pay 9.99 a month and you can see one movie a day every day in theaters.  I thought it was too good to be true and naturally I took to the internet.  Unfortunately, tons of keyboard warriors were in uproar over this app.  They claimed to be wrongfully barred or resubscribed or whatever reason people complain about these days.  I don't know if their claims were valid but this has been my experience....      Once a week during the week, my husband and I get in the car and head to the movie theater.  Once we park we check in using the app and it loads a credit to the card you are issued be movie pass or gives you an eticket code.  We go to the counter and announce the movi...
